Deconstructing Tone: Understanding the Nuances
Before we dive into manipulation, let’s establish a solid foundation. Tone refers to the emotional atmosphere your writing evokes.
It’s distinct from the content itself; a serious topic can be presented humorously, while a light-hearted subject can take on a more somber tone.
The ability to manipulate tone effectively allows you to:
- Connect with your audience: The right tone fosters an emotional connection, making your writing relatable and engaging.
- Elicit specific responses: A humorous tone can make readers laugh, while a persuasive tone can sway their opinion.
- Control the reading experience: A suspenseful tone keeps readers on the edge of their seats, while an informative tone delivers knowledge clearly and concisely.
Gemini’s Toolbox for Tone Manipulation:
So how does Gemini help you achieve this mastery of tone? Here’s a glimpse into its arsenal:
- Word Choice Analysis: The cornerstone of tone manipulation lies in word selection. Gemini dissects your writing, identifying the emotional weight of each word.
Prompt: “Analyze the word choice of this paragraph. Does it convey the desired [desired tone]?”
Example: Imagine you’re writing a travel blog post about a backpacking trip in Nepal. You want to capture the awe-inspiring beauty of the Himalayas. Gemini will analyze your word choices and suggest alternatives that evoke a sense of grandeur and wonder, replacing “big mountain” with “majestic peak” or swapping “walk” with “trek”. - Sentence Structure and Flow: Sentence structure plays a significant role in tone. Short, choppy sentences often create a sense of urgency or excitement, while long, fluid sentences lend a more formal or contemplative air.
Prompt: “How can I rewrite this sentence to sound more [desired tone]?”
Example: You’re crafting a scene in a mystery novel where the protagonist is chasing a suspect through a dark alley. Gemini can analyze the flow of your sentences and suggest shorter, fragmented structures to heighten the sense of urgency and chaos. - Figurative Language: Figurative language adds depth and emotional resonance to your writing. Metaphors and similes can paint vivid pictures, while personification can imbue objects with human emotions.
Prompt: “Suggest specific figures of speech to enhance the [desired tone] of this passage.”
Example: Let’s say you’re writing a children’s bedtime story. Gemini can propose incorporating playful metaphors and similes to create a whimsical and imaginative atmosphere. The sun might not just “set,” it might “tuck itself under the covers of the mountains.”
Beyond the Basics: Unveiling Gemini’s Advanced Techniques
The manipulation of tone extends beyond simple word choice and sentence structure. Gemini goes a step further by offering advanced techniques:
- Descriptive Language: Vivid descriptions allow readers to visualize your world and experience its emotional essence.
Prompt: “How can I describe this scene to evoke a sense of [desired tone]?”
Example: Imagine setting the scene for a tense negotiation in a high-stakes business deal. Gemini can analyze your descriptive language and suggest focusing on details that convey power, like the starkly lit conference room or the stoic expressions of the characters.
- Dialogue Analysis: Dialogue is a powerful tool for conveying character personalities and advancing the plot. The tone of your characters’ dialogue can reveal their emotions, social status, and relationships.
Prompt: “Does the dialogue in this scene effectively convey the characters’ personalities and the [desired tone]?” - Example: You’re writing a witty banter between two best friends. Gemini can analyze their dialogue to ensure it strikes the right balance between humor and sincerity, suggesting sarcasm or playful jabs to maintain the lighthearted tone.
- Transition Words and Phrases: Transitions are often overlooked, but they play a crucial role in shaping the overall flow and tone of your writing.
Prompt: “Suggest transition words that would create a more [desired tone] flow between these paragraphs.”
Example: You’re writing a persuasive essay on the importance of environmental conservation. Gemini can recommend stronger transitions that emphasize cause and effect or logical connections, solidifying the persuasive tone. - Point-of-View: The narrative perspective significantly impacts how readers perceive the story and its emotional core.
Prompt: “Would changing the point-of-view impact the overall [desired tone] of the story?”
Example: Let’s say you’re writing a historical fiction novel about a young woman during the French Revolution. Switching from a detached third-person to a first-person narrative, filled with the character’s anxieties and hopes, can intensify the emotional impact and create a more immersive and suspenseful tone.
